  2. Harpreet Singh Bhatia (born 11 August 1991) is an Indian cricketer who plays for the Chhattisgarh cricket team and Central Zone in Indian domestic cricket. He is a left-hand batsman and right-arm medium pace bowler. He was a member of the Pune Warriors India squad in the 2011 Indian Premier League.

  4. Aug 11, 1991 · Harpreet Singh Bhatia, the 31-year-old batter, was acquired by Punjab Kings for Rs. 40 lakhs. He has featured in 84 List-A matches and notched up 3023 runs at an average of 45.11. In the shortest format, Bhatia has scored 2202 runs in 77 games at a strike rate of 124.54.

  8. Apr 16, 2023 · Harpreet Singh Bhatia played his first IPL game in 2023 after a gap of 10 years and 332 days. He was a victim of a mistaken identity case in 2012 that affected his IPL chances.
